0
辞書をファイルに保存しようとしています。常にこのcPickleエラーが常に発生しますか?
これは私のコードの一部です:
Accounts={}
if username not in Accounts:
Accounts[username]=password
database=open("my_mail_database", "w")
pickle.dump(Accounts, database)
database.close()
そして、私はいつもこのエラーが出る:
Traceback (most recent call last):
File "C:\Python34\lib\tkinter\__init__.py", line 1538, in __call__
return self.func(*args)
File "C:\Python34\python 3.4\my_gmail2.pyw", line 51, in submit_account
pickle.dump(Accounts, database)
TypeError: must be str, not bytes
誰かがいただきました!私のコードの問題を教えてもらえますか?
http://stackoverflow.com/questions/13906623/using-pickle-dump-typeerror-must-be-str- WBでファイルを開く必要がありますnot-bytes – zezollo